Bola Tinubu returns to Nigeria
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on LinkedinShare on Whatsapp

Presidential candidate of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Asiwaju Bola Tinubu, on Thursday returned to Nigeria.

Tinubu returned to the country from the United Kingdom where he was alleged to have travelled to attend to his failing health.

He was absent at the signing of the peace accord by 17 candidates last week, creating an impression that he was sick.

The situation forced the candidate and his media handlers to release series of photographs and videos to dispel the rumour of his ill health.

Among those who received him at the Nnamdi Azikwe Airport were his running mate, Senator Kashim Shettima; his campaign DG and Plateau State Governor, Simon Lalong, and a former APC national chairman, Adams Oshiomhole, among others.

Tinubu is expected to engage in a series of political consultations by meeting members of his Presidential Campaign Council, Progressive Governors Forum and the National Working Committee of the APC in separate meetings to discuss the contentious campaign list.
